You can change your default shell using the chsh (“change shell” ) command as follows. The syntax is: $ chsh $ chsh -s {shell-name-here} $ sudo chsh -s {shell-name-here} {user-name-here} $ chsh -s /bin/bash $ chsh -s /bin/bash vivek You can find full path to your shell using the following type command or … Meer weergeven Type the following command to find out the default shell for a user named vivek using the grep command and /etc/passwd file: $ grep -w … Meer weergeven Type the name at the command line and then press the enter key. In this example, to change from any shell to the bash, type: $ bash Meer weergeven The only restriction placed on the login shell is that the shell command name must be listed in /etc/shells file, unless the invoker is the superuser/root user, and then any value may be added. Web14 jul. 2015 · For those who don't want to rely on search to find the appropriate panel, right-click the Start menu and select "System" to launch the System control panel. Then click "Advanced system settings" from the left-side column. On the "System Properties" window that pops up, click "Environment Variables..." to launch the environment variable editor.
